5 Signs That You Need to Replace Your Siding
Your home’s siding is more than just an aesthetic feature; it serves as a protective barrier against the elements and contributes to energy efficiency. Over time, siding can deteriorate, compromising both its functionality and appearance. Here are five signs that indicate it’s time to replace your siding:
1) Visible Damage:
Cracks, chips, or holes in your siding are clear indicators of damage. These flaws not only detract from your home’s curb appeal but also expose it to moisture, pests, and mold. If you notice extensive damage, it’s essential to address it promptly to prevent further deterioration.
2) Peeling or Warping:
Siding that is peeling, buckling, or warping is a sign of moisture infiltration. When moisture seeps behind the siding, it can cause the material to swell or warp. This not only compromises the integrity of your siding but also indicates potential water damage to the underlying structure of your home.
3) Fading Color:
Over time, exposure to sunlight can cause siding to fade or discolor. While some fading is normal, excessive discoloration may indicate that your siding is reaching the end of its lifespan. Faded siding not only diminishes your home’s appearance but also suggests that the material may no longer be providing adequate protection.
4) Increased Energy Bills:
If you notice a sudden spike in your energy bills, your siding could be to blame. Damaged or outdated siding can compromise your home’s insulation, leading to heat loss in the winter and heat gain in the summer. By replacing your siding with a more energy-efficient option, you can improve your home’s thermal performance and reduce energy costs.
5) Mold or Mildew Growth:
Mold and mildew thrive in moist environments, making them common problems for deteriorating siding. If you notice mold or mildew growth on your siding, it’s essential to address the issue promptly to prevent it from spreading to other areas of your home. Replacing your siding with a moisture-resistant material can help prevent future mold growth and protect your home’s indoor air quality.
Keeping an eye out for these five signs can help you determine when it’s time to replace your siding. By addressing issues promptly, you can protect your home from further damage and maintain its value and curb appeal for years to come.
